Understanding Lag and Its Causes:
Before diving into mod evaluation, it is crucial to understand what lag is and what factors contribute to it. Lag in Minecraft refers to a delay or slowdown in the game's responsiveness, leading to stuttering movement, delayed actions, and decreased overall performance. Common causes of lag include excessive server load, high entity counts, inefficient code, or resource-intensive mods.
Evaluating Mod Performance:
1. Research Mod Reputation:Before installing any mod, research its reputation within the Minecraft community. Seek out reviews, feedback from other server administrators, and any known performance issues associated with the mod.
2. Check Mod Compatibility:Ensure the mod you intend to install is compatible with your Minecraft server version and other installed mods. Incompatibilities can lead to conflicts and performance issues.
3. Test in Controlled Environments:Create a controlled testing environment, perhaps on a separate test server, to evaluate the mod's performance impact. Measure FPS (Frames Per Second) changes and assess any noticeable slowdowns.
4. Monitor Server Metrics:Use server monitoring tools to track CPU usage, RAM usage, tick rate, and other relevant metrics. Monitor these metrics with and without the mod to determine its impact on server performance.
5. Identify Resource-Intensive Mods:Some mods consume a significant amount of server resources due to complex calculations, large textures, or frequent updates. Identify such mods and consider their necessity based on the overall server experience.
6. Optimize Configuration:Many mods provide configuration files that allow you to tweak their behavior. Adjust settings to strike a balance between functionality and performance.
7. Prioritize Server Optimization:Regularly optimize your Minecraft server by using performance-enhancing plugins, reducing entity counts, and employing world generation tools to lighten the server load.
8. Community Feedback:Engage with your server community to gather feedback on mod performance. They may notice issues that you might have overlooked, helping you make informed decisions.
